New Directions Youth and Family Services recently opened the Wayne A. Secord Therapeutic Preschool in Lockport to help emotionally and behaviorally challenged four-year-olds get back on track in time to start traditional kindergarten.  These children are receiving the specialized attention and nurturing environment that they so desperately need.
